Two sentenced in sports-betting ring operated out of Borgata poker room 2/14/2009 Joseph Wishnick and Robert Mackie pleaded guilty Dec. 15 to third-degree promotion of gambling charges in the bookmaking ring housed in the Borgata Hotel Casino & Spa. Both said they were agents of the ring.
